Definition
A bell-shaped winter squash with sweet, nutty, orange flesh, commonly roasted, pureed, or used in soups.

Optimal Storage Temperature
50-55°F (10-13°C) for 1-3 months

Per 1 cup (cubed, 140g)Chef’s Secret
Roasting butternut squash cut-side down helps steam the flesh, making it incredibly tender and easier to scoop out.
Substitutions
Acorn Squash
1:1Similar flavor profile (nutty, slightly sweet) and texture, good for roasting.
Sweet Potato
1:1Provides similar sweetness, color, and creamy texture when cooked, excellent in purees.
Pumpkin (Sugar Pie)
1:1Great for purees, soups, and pies, similar sweetness and texture.
Spaghetti Squash
1:1Different texture (strand-like), but offers a mild, savory base for dishes.
Buying Guide
Choose squash that is heavy for its size, firm, and free of blemishes.
